Dick

proper nouncommon in dialogue

  • //dɪk//

A diminutive of the male given name Richard, also used as a formal given name.

proper noun

  1. 1

    A diminutive of the male given name Richard, also used as a formal given name.

    Lascivious Edward, and thou perjur'd George, / And thou mis-shapen Dick, I tell ye all,

    You may know what one man thinks of another by his manner of calling him. Thomas and James and Richard and William are stupid young gentlemen; Tom and Jem and Dick and Will are fine spirited fellows.

  2. 2

    A surname transferred from the given name.

Etymology

Rhyming nickname for Rick, pet form of Richard.
